La Maitresse de Brecht is a true life (?) / fictional (?) account of an actress named Maria Eich, who is recruited by East German police during the cold war to spy on famed German poet/playwright Bertolt Brecht.The novel is rather sparse on detail as to how Maria catches Brechts eye, however, they do eventually live together (in the... castellano Captures well the claustrophobic atmosphere of East Germany in the years after Brecht's return and the growth of the Stasi. Much more about Maria Eich, who is set to spy on Brecht, than on the man himself, although it follows the basic outline of his life from return to his death.
